Why is my car suddenly using so much more fuel?

Your car might suddenly be consuming more fuel due to a combination of factors, including neglected maintenance, aggressive driving habits, or failing engine components and sensors. These issues often work together to quietly erode your fuel economy, making your daily drives more expensive without an obvious warning light appearing.

Pinpointing the exact cause can be tricky without the right tools. Many problems that affect fuel economy do not immediately trigger a dashboard warning, making them hard for drivers to identify. However, understanding the common culprits can help you start looking in the right direction.

How does poor maintenance affect fuel economy?

Poor vehicle maintenance significantly impacts your fuel economy because neglected components force your engine to work harder, consuming more fuel in the process. Simple things like dirty air filters, old spark plugs, or overdue oil changes can collectively reduce efficiency and cost you more at the pump.

For instance, a clogged air filter starves your engine of oxygen, making it less efficient, while worn spark plugs can lead to incomplete combustion. Automotive Globe Specialist (2026) reports that poor vehicle maintenance can increase fuel consumption by approximately 10-30%. This significant range highlights just how much of your hard-earned money can be wasted on neglected upkeep. In the UK, approximately 23% of cars fail their first MOT test each year, often due to preventable issues that also contribute to poor fuel economy.

Regular maintenance, though it costs money upfront, is an investment that pays off in improved fuel economy and extended vehicle life. What role do my driving habits play in fuel consumption?

Your driving habits play a substantial role in how much fuel your car uses, with aggressive driving being a major culprit that can drastically reduce your fuel economy. Rapid acceleration, hard braking, and speeding all force your engine to burn more fuel than necessary as it works harder to meet these demands.

The U.S. Department of Energy (2026) highlights that aggressive driving, including rapid acceleration and hard braking, can reduce fuel economy by up to 40% in city driving and 30% on highways. This is because every time you accelerate quickly, your engine injects more fuel, and every time you brake hard, that kinetic energy is wasted as heat rather than being efficiently used.

What are the most common reasons for a sudden drop in MPG?

Common reasons include underinflated tires, dirty air filters, faulty oxygen sensors, worn spark plugs, clogged fuel injectors, and issues with the mass airflow sensor. Aggressive driving habits can also significantly reduce fuel economy.

Can a 'Check Engine' light be related to poor fuel economy?

Yes, a 'Check Engine' light often illuminates when a sensor affecting the fuel-air mixture, such as an oxygen sensor or mass airflow sensor, is malfunctioning, which directly impacts fuel efficiency.
